微信扫一扫 分享朋友圈

已有 9242 人浏览分享

开启左侧

thinkpad t400 笔记本电脑蓝屏iaStor.sys

[复制链接]
9242 4

笔记本蓝屏了该怎么办呢?近期重装了电脑之后,好不容易把笔记本的所有驱动装好了,但经常会出现蓝屏重启,后来把错误发送到 Microsoft 说是由驱动引起的,那么我们先来找错误原因吧。




第一步:打开“小内存转储”功能
右键点击“我的电脑”,选“属性→高级→启动和故障恢复→设置”,打开“启动和故障恢复”选项卡,在“写入调试  信息”下拉列表中选中“小内存转储(64KB)”选项.选好后点“确定”,这样操作系统在下次出现蓝屏时,就会记录下当时内存中的数据,并存储为dump文件,该文件存放在系统盘的minidump文件夹下。


相关知识点:
1、小内存转储:内存转储是用于系统崩溃时,将内存中的数据转储保存在转储文件中,供给有关人员进行排错分析使用。小内存转储,就是只保存内存前64KB的基本空间数据的内存转储文件。这样可以节省磁盘空间,也方便文件的查看。
2、Dump文件:Dump文件是用来给驱动程序编写人员调试驱动程序用的,这种文件必须用专用工具软件打开,比如使用WinDbg打开


第二步:从微软的网站下载安装WinDbg
  WinDbg是微软发布的一款优秀的源码级调试工具,可以调试Dump文件,这里我们用来查找蓝屏故障的原因,下载地址为:http://www.microsoft.com/whdc/devtools/debugging/installx86.mspx。这个过程就不赘述了。安装时,一路选“下一步”就行了。

第三步:使用WinDbg诊断蓝屏错误
    上诉工作准备好后,当系统再次出现蓝屏后重启,在minidump文件夹下就会出现一个以日期为文件名的.dmp文件,这就是我们要分析的文件。接下来点击“开始菜单→程序→Debugging tools for windows(x86)-WinDbg”,打开WinDbg程序,点击程序窗口的“File→Open Crash Dump”,打开位于系统盘的minidump文件夹下的以日期为文件名的.dmp文件


打开后程序就开始自动分析蓝屏错误文件了,分析完后,看最下面,找到“Probably caused by”这一行,其后面的文件就是引起蓝屏的源文件。大家就可以看到类似如下的界面


从该窗口,我们就可以看到是“360AntiArp.sys”这个文件导致电脑蓝屏.

注:以上是网上找得方法,本人出现蓝屏的是“iaStor.sys”,有人说是版本原因,要替换掉。我在c:/windows/system32/driver/目录下找到iaStor.Sys查看其版本是8.6.0.1007的,网上还有7.0.3.1001和8.8.0.1009。这里我替换成了8.8的了。

替换方法:重启电脑-进入安全模式-拷贝8.8的覆盖掉8.6的。

评论 4

提枪夜袭女儿村  V3+  发表于 2009-11-19 22:30 | 显示全部楼层
技术 帖学习了
白可蓝  V3+  发表于 2009-11-20 08:47 | 显示全部楼层
这个帖子学到很多东西 顶起来……
Julireve  注册会员  发表于 2009-11-28 14:48 | 显示全部楼层
不错看网上蓝屏还挺多的
小鱼吃大鱼  V3+  发表于 2009-12-5 10:36 | 显示全部楼层
反正我的没有蓝过
您需要登录后才可以回帖 登录 | 注册

本版积分规则

V3+

0

关注

21

粉丝

12

主题
精彩推荐
热门资讯
网友晒图
图文推荐
  • 微信公众平台

  • 扫描访问手机版

Archiver|手机版|小黑屋|水窝ibm

GMT+8, 2024-11-24 12:24 , Processed in 0.080490 second(s), 23 queries .

Powered by Discuz! X3.5

© 2001-2022 Comsenz Inc.